Abstract:
This research aims to explore the scientific and methodological aspects of increasing the availability of environmentally friendly food for the population. This is to be achieved through advancements in organic and climate-resilient green agriculture, with a focus on sustainable resource management and protection. This research also examines practical approaches to this goal. The authors assessed the current availability of organic, eco-friendly products for the population, with a particular emphasis on developing green agriculture within the broader framework of the green economy. The research identifies key challenges in this sector and proposes practical solutions to address them. The economic analysis in this research draws from legal, regulatory, and methodological materials related to agriculture in Kyrgyzstan, as well as the economic relationships among business entities. The research conclusions are based on scientifically sound methods, supported by principles of economics and the recommendations of domestic and international experts.
